The birds were chanting in an uncanny manner. The dark patches of clouds above my head were being tormented by lightening. I was waiting for the clouds to shed their tears. My desperation to feel the coolness of rain grew as time passed by. The only thought which clutched my mind was that of Neil. I needed to distract myself from my feelings. I kept rewinding the scene in my head with him.
"Nina, I love you. Please don't do this." His hands framed my face as his restlessness grew.
"You have to move on. This was never going to work anyway. I have to move to another city. It's how the system works."
"I will move there. I will follow you. I love you." He planted kisses all over my face, he spared no effort to make me stay.
"You can't. You have another life you have to think about now. Don't abandon her before she's even born." He knew what I was referring to and the creases near his eyes seemed to soften a little bit.
"I don't know what to do." His eyes watered. I pulled him into an embrace and moved my fingers through his hair.
"Yes, you do baby. You do know."
I woke by a sound. It sounded like a wild animal, an injured and wailing animal. It was the kind of sound that made your skin tingle and made you press your hands to your ears and scream for it to go away. Whoever the source was, he wasn't very close.
I was surrounded by darkness. Complete and utter darkness, but I had a feeling that I wasn't alone. I could hear the slow and steady breaths of whoever was in the room along with me. A sharp pain struck me as I tried to lift my head from the floor. It was probably the after-effect of whatever they had injected me with. It felt like an enormous rock attached to the back of my head.
"Hello?"
"Mia, is that you?" Lauren. Relief washed over me as I heard her voice.
"Lauren? Oh my god, are you okay?"
"Yes! My hands and legs are bound. What about you?" I was so busy processing the surrounding darkness that I didn't notice my hands were tied too, along with my legs.
"Same. How long have we been here?" I whispered.
"Two to three hours is what I'm guessing. I'm not sure, I came back to my senses a while back too."
"IS ANYBODY OUT HERE?" I yelled as loud as I could. Lauren tuned along with me but silence came back as an answer.
Nothing could be done in the situation that we were in. If I managed to get hold of something sharp then I might have been able to cut the rope loose but that seemed unlikely considering how dark the room was and the abductors weren't so stupid that they'd leave sharp objects lying around in the room.
"Sit tight, Lauren. We just have to wait." I said and leaned against the wall, planning out a number of strategies in my head. It was not the first time I found myself to be in such a situation.
My eyes opened at once as I heard footsteps approaching. "Lauren, are you there?"
"Yes, I hear them coming too."
